
توظيف شريك تطوير تطبيقات الجوال: ما يحتاج مديرو التكنولوجيا معرفته
يعد اختيار الشريك المناسب لتطوير تطبيقات الجوال أحد أهم القرارات التي يمكن أن يتخذها مدير التكنولوجيا. مع تحول تطبيقات الجوال إلى نقطة الاتصال الأساسية لتفاعل العملاء، فإن الاختيار بين البناء الداخلي أو توظيف المستقلين أو الشراكة مع وكالة تطوير له آثار كبيرة على وقت الوصول إلى السوق والجودة وقابلية الصيانة طويلة الأجل. يوفر هذا الدليل إطار عمل منظم لتقييم الشركاء المحتملين وفهم نماذج التعاقد واتخاذ خيارات تقنية مستنيرة تتوافق مع أهداف عملك.
Native مقابل Cross-Platform: اتخاذ القرار التقنی
لا تزال مناقشة Native مقابل Cross-Platform واحدة من أهم القرارات التقنية في تطوير تطبيقات الجوال. يوفر التطوير Native (Swift/SwiftUI لـ iOS، Kotlin لـ Android) أقصى أداء ووصول كامل للميزات الخاصة بالمنصة وأفضل تجربة مستخدم، ولكنه يتطلب الحفاظ على قواعد أكواد وفرق منفصلة. تعد أطر العمل Cross-Platform مثل React Native و Flutter بتوفير كبير في التكاليف من خلال إعادة استخدام الكود (عادةً 70-90٪ من الكود المشترك) ووقت أسرع للوصول إلى السوق مع فريق تطوير واحد. يقدم React Native، المدعوم من Meta والمستخدم من قبل شركات مثل Microsoft و Shopify، أداءً ممتازًا لمعظم التطبيقات ونظامًا بيئيًا واسعًا من المكتبات. يوفر Flutter، الذي طورته Google، أداءً قريبًا من Native ويكتسب تبنيًا سريعًا في البيئات المؤسسية. يجب أن يأخذ إطار القرار في الاعتبار: تعقيد التطبيق ومتطلبات الأداء، قيود الميزانية، الوقت المطلوب للوصول إلى السوق، توفر الميزات الخاصة بالمنصة التي تحتاجها، والخبرة التقنية الحالية لفريقك. بالنسبة لمعظم تطبيقات الأعمال التي لا تتطلب رسومات مكثفة أو تكاملات Native معقدة، يوفر React Native التوازن الأمثل بين التكلفة والجودة وسرعة التطوير.
تقييم شركاء التطوير: معايير الاختيار الرئيسية
يتطلب تقييم شركاء التطوير المحتملين نهجًا منظمًا عبر أبعاد متعددة. يجب أن تُظهر المحفظة ودراسات الحالة خبرة صناعية ذات صلة وتعقيدًا تقنيًا يتناسب مع احتياجاتك—ابحث عن تطبيقات منشورة يمكنك تنزيلها واختبارها، وليس مجرد لقطات شاشة. يجب أن تمتد الخبرة التقنية إلى ما هو أبعد من التطوير الأساسي لتشمل تصميم البنية وأفضل ممارسات الأمان وتحسين App Store والخبرة في التكاملات مع أطراف ثالثة (بوابات الدفع والتحليلات والإشعارات الفورية). نضج عملية التطوير أمر بالغ الأهمية: قيّم استخدامهم لمنهجيات Agile وتخطيط Sprint وممارسات مراجعة الكود والاختبار الآلي وخطوط CI/CD. البنية التحتية للاتصالات مهمة بشكل كبير—حدد التوقعات حول أوقات الاستجابة وإيقاع الاجتماعات وأدوات إدارة المشاريع (Jira، Linear، ClickUp) وما إذا كانوا يوفرون مدير مشروع مخصص. اطلب مراجع من العملاء السابقين، خاصة أولئك الذين لديهم نطاقات مشاريع مماثلة، واسأل أسئلة محددة حول الالتزام بالجداول الزمنية وإدارة الميزانية والدعم بعد الإطلاق. التوافق الثقافي وتداخل المنطقة الزمنية يؤثران على جودة التعاون—تداخل 2-3 ساعات يسهل حل المشكلات في الوقت الفعلي. العلامات الحمراء تشمل: التردد في التوقيع على اتفاقيات السرية، عدم وجود عملية تطوير واضحة، عدم القدرة على توضيح المقايضات التقنية، عدم وجود عملية ضمان الجودة، والتواصل الضعيف خلال عملية البيع (والذي يتدهور عادة أثناء التطوير). أفضل الشركاء يتحدون متطلباتك بشكل بناء، ويقترحون تحسينات بناءً على خبرتهم، ويُظهرون اهتمامًا حقيقيًا بنجاح عملك بدلاً من مجرد تنفيذ المواصفات.
نماذج التعاقد: اختيار هيكل الشراكة المناسب
يؤثر نموذج التعاقد بشكل كبير على نتائج المشروع وتوزيع المخاطر وقابلية التنبؤ بالميزانية. تعمل العقود ذات السعر الثابت بشكل جيد للمشاريع ذات المتطلبات المحددة بوضوح والتغييرات المتوقعة الحد الأدنى والنطاق المفهوم جيدًا—عادةً المشاريع الأصغر (2-4 أشهر) أو إضافات ميزات محددة. يتحمل البائع مخاطر التنفيذ ولكنه قد يضيف هامش طوارئ للسعر، وغالبًا ما تؤدي طلبات التغيير إلى إعادة مفاوضات طويلة. يوفر الوقت والمواد (T&M) مرونة للمتطلبات المتطورة، مما يجعله مثاليًا للمنتجات المعقدة حيث يستمر الاكتشاف. تدفع مقابل الساعات المعملة الفعلية (عادةً الفواتير الأسبوعية أو نصف الشهرية)، مع الحفاظ على السيطرة الكاملة على الأولويات وتمكين التحولات السريعة. ومع ذلك، يتطلب T&M مشاركة نشطة من العميل في إدارة backlog ويحمل عدم يقين في الميزانية ما لم يكن محددًا بسقف. يوفر نموذج الفريق المخصص حلاً وسطًا: تحصل على تكلفة شهرية ثابتة للموارد المخصصة (المطورون والمصممون وQA) الذين يعملون حصريًا على مشروعك، مما يجمع بين مرونة T&M وقابلية أفضل للتنبؤ بالتكلفة. هذا النموذج مناسب للتعاقدات الأطول (6+ أشهر) ويتوسع بشكل جيد مع تطور المتطلبات. الأساليب الهجينة شائعة—سعر ثابت لـ MVP الأولي، ثم الانتقال إلى T&M أو فريق مخصص للتطوير المستمر. شروط العقد الرئيسية للتفاوض: ملكية الملكية الفكرية (يجب أن تمتلك جميع الكود والتصاميم)، معالم الدفع المرتبطة بقبول التسليم (وليس فقط الإنجاز)، فترة ضمان إصلاح الأخطاء (عادةً 30-90 يومًا بعد الإطلاق)، اتفاقيات مستوى الخدمة للأخطاء الحرجة، وبنود إنهاء واضحة. بالنسبة للشركاء الخارجيين، ضع في اعتبارك الولاية القضائية القانونية وآليات حل النزاعات. تبدأ معظم التعاقدات الناجحة بمرحلة اكتشاف مدفوعة (2-4 أسابيع) تنتج مواصفات فنية مفصلة وإطارات سلكية وخارطة طريق للتطوير—هذا الاستثمار يقلل بشكل كبير من سوء الاتصال النهائي ونزاعات النطاق.
إدارة التطوير والاعتبارات بعد الإطلاق
تتطلب الإدارة الفعالة للتطوير الخارجي إنشاء عمليات واضحة والحفاظ على رقابة متسقة. قم بتنفيذ دورات sprint كل أسبوعين مع احتفالات محددة: تخطيط Sprint (مراجعة المتطلبات والتقدير)، اجتماعات يومية (التحديثات غير المتزامنة مقبولة مع اختلافات المنطقة الزمنية)، مراجعات Sprint (عرض توضيحي للعمل المكتمل)، واستعراضات (تحسين العملية). استخدم مصدرًا واحدًا للحقيقة للمتطلبات—أدوات مثل Linear أو Jira أو ClickUp مع قصص مستخدم مفصلة تتضمن معايير القبول وروابط التصميم وتسميات الأولوية. يجب أن يتضمن تسليم التصميم نماذج عالية الدقة في Figma أو Adobe XD، ونظام تصميم/مكتبة مكونات، ومواصفات نقاط الانقطاع المستجيبة، ونماذج تفاعلية للتدفقات المعقدة. تتطلب صيانة جودة الكود وضع معايير مسبقًا: إنشاء وثيقة قرارات مجموعة التكنولوجيا والهندسة المعمارية، فرض عمليات مراجعة الكود (مراجعتان على الأقل للميزات الحرجة)، تحديد متطلبات الاختبار (الحد الأدنى لتغطية اختبار الوحدة، اختبارات التكامل للمسارات الحرجة)، وتنفيذ الفحوصات الآلية عبر CI/CD (linting، فحص الأمان، التحقق من البناء). يمنع التقييم المنتظم للديون التقنية التراكم—خصص 15-20٪ من قدرة Sprint لإعادة الهيكلة وتحسين الأداء. تحسين App Store والتقديم مهارة متخصصة: احسب 1-2 أسبوع لعمليات المراجعة الأولية، أعد مواد التسويق (لقطات الشاشة، مقاطع الفيديو التمهيدية، الأوصاف) مسبقًا، فهم الإرشادات الخاصة بالمنصة (خاصة معايير المراجعة الصارمة من Apple)، وخطط للرفض المحتمل الذي يتطلب تكرارات سريعة. بعد الإطلاق، تصبح الصيانة والدعم أمرًا بالغ الأهمية: حدد مستويات الخطورة للأخطاء (P0 حرجة-توقف الإنتاج، P1 عالية-ميزة رئيسية معطلة، P2 متوسطة-مشكلة بسيطة، P3 منخفضة-تجميلية)، أنشئ اتفاقيات مستوى الخدمة للاستجابة والحل لكل مستوى، خطط لتحديثات نظام التشغيل (iOS و Android يصدران إصدارات رئيسية جديدة سنويًا)، وخصص ميزانية للتصحيحات الأمنية المستمرة وتحديثات التبعية. يتيح تكامل التحليلات من الإطلاق (Firebase، Mixpanel، Amplitude) التكرار المستند إلى البيانات—قم بإعداد تدفقات المستخدم الرئيسية وقمع التحويل قبل الإطلاق. تختلف اعتبارات التكلفة بشكل كبير حسب المنطقة: أوروبا الشرقية ($40-70/ساعة) تقدم مهارات تقنية قوية مع توافق ثقافي أفضل للعملاء الغربيين، أمريكا اللاتينية ($35-60/ساعة) توفر تداخل المنطقة الزمنية الأمثل لشركات الولايات المتحدة، آسيا ($25-50/ساعة) توفر كفاءة التكلفة ولكن قد تكون هناك فجوات اتصال أكبر، والخيارات القريبة من الشاطئ عادة ما تكلف أكثر ولكنها تقلل من احتكاك التنسيق. تمتد التكلفة الإجمالية للملكية إلى ما بعد التطوير—ضع ميزانية لرسوم App Store ($99/سنة iOS، $25 مرة واحدة Android)، وخدمات الطرف الثالث (المصادقة، المدفوعات، الإشعارات الفورية، التحليلات)، واستضافة البنية التحتية الخلفية، والصيانة المستمرة (عادة 15-20٪ من تكلفة التطوير الأولية سنويًا).
اتخاذ القرار النهائي
يتعلق قرار الشراكة مع فريق تطوير تطبيقات جوال خارجي في النهاية بإيجاد التوازن الصحيح بين القدرة التقنية وفعالية الاتصال وكفاءة التكلفة والمواءمة الثقافية. ابدأ بتعريف واضح لمقاييس النجاح: معايير الجودة (أهداف معدل خالية من الأعطال، معايير الأداء)، التزامات الجدول الزمني، ومعايير الميزانية. فكر في تشغيل إثبات مفهوم مدفوع أو مشروع تجريبي (2-4 أسابيع، $5,000-15,000) قبل الالتزام بالتطوير الكامل—هذا يتحقق من القدرة التقنية وأنماط الاتصال وتوافق أسلوب العمل مع الحد الأدنى من المخاطر. تتميز أفضل الشراكات بحل المشكلات الاستباقي والتواصل الشفاف حول التحديات والمخاطر ونقل المعرفة المنتظم إلى فريقك وتوافق الحوافز بما يتجاوز مجرد إكمال المهام. يتطلب النجاح على المدى الطويل معاملة الفريق الخارجي كامتداد لمنظمتك بدلاً من مجرد بائع—استثمر في بناء العلاقات، وشارك سياق وأهداف العمل، وأنشئ حلقات تعليقات للتحسين المستمر. تذكر أن الخيار الأقل تكلفة نادرًا ما يقدم أفضل قيمة؛ شريك أكثر تكلفة قليلاً مع عمليات اتصال وجودة فائقة عادة ما يقلل من التكلفة الإجمالية للملكية من خلال دورات إعادة عمل أقل وقابلية أفضل للصيانة ومشكلات أقل بعد الإطلاق. يتطور مشهد الجوال بسرعة، لذا اختر شركاء ملتزمين بالتعلم المستمر والذين يظهرون القدرة على التكيف في خياراتهم التكنولوجية. أخيرًا، تأكد من أن الشراكة تتضمن نقل المعرفة والتوثيق طوال المشروع—لا يجب أن تجد نفسك أبدًا في موقف حيث يفهم شريك التطوير فقط الجوانب الحرجة لتطبيقك. مع التقييم الشامل والتوقعات الواضحة والإدارة النشطة، يمكن أن تؤدي الشراكة مع فريق تطوير تطبيقات الجوال المناسب إلى تسريع وقت الوصول إلى السوق بشكل كبير مع الحفاظ على معايير الجودة والتحكم في التكاليف.